    Creative Scrapbook Ideas for Weddings

    Creating a scrapbook for your wedding captures the essence of your special day. Here are some engaging ideas to inspire you.

    Themed Scrapbook Concepts

    1. Seasonal Themes: Choose themes based on the season of your wedding. For a spring wedding, use floral patterns, pastel colors, and nature-inspired decorations. For a winter wedding, opt for snowflakes, warm hues, and cozy textures.
    2. Destination Weddings: Highlight the location with themed elements. Use maps, local souvenirs, and pictures showcasing the venue. Incorporate cultural motifs that reflect the area’s charm.
    3. Color Palette: Stick to the wedding’s color scheme. Use matching papers, embellishments, and stickers to create a cohesive look that ties all elements together.
    4. Vintage Vibes: Embrace a vintage style with sepia-toned photos and retro decorations. Incorporate lace, pearls, and antique accents to give your scrapbook a timeless feel.

    Essential Supplies for Wedding Scrapbooking

    Creating a wedding scrapbook requires specific supplies to capture every beautiful moment. These essentials ensure that your project runs smoothly and results in a cherished keepsake.

    • Scrapbook Album: Choose an album that fits your style and can hold all your pages. Look for ones with protective sleeves.
    • Paper and Cardstock: Select patterned paper and solid cardstock in your wedding color palette. Use textured options for added depth.
    • Adhesives: Use acid-free glue sticks, double-sided tape, or photo-safe adhesives. These keep your photos secure without damaging them.
    • Scissors and Trimmers: Have sharp scissors and a paper trimmer for precise cuts. This helps create clean edges for your layout.
    • Embellishments: Gather stickers, ribbons, and embellishments that match your theme. These add extra flair and personalization to your pages.
    • Pens and Markers: Use acid-free pens and markers for journaling and captions. Choose a variety of colors to highlight different elements.
    • Photo Printer: Consider a portable photo printer for instant prints. This allows you to work on your scrapbook as you collect memories.
    • Protective Sleeves: Invest in protective sleeves to preserve your scrapbook pages. These sleeves keep pages safe from wear and tear.
    • Templates and Stencils: Use templates and stencils for creating consistent designs. This helps maintain a cohesive look throughout your scrapbook.

    Keep these supplies handy to ensure a smooth scrapbooking process. With these essentials, your wedding memories will come to life beautifully on every page.

    Tips for Organizing Wedding Scrapbook Pages

    Organizing your wedding scrapbook pages can enhance the storytelling aspect of your memories. Follow these tips to ensure a cohesive and visually appealing scrapbook.

    Sequencing Events and Memories

    1. Chronological Order: Arrange your pages in the sequence of your wedding day. Start with your engagement, then move on to the preparations, ceremony, and reception. This structure helps tell a natural story.
    2. Key Moments: Highlight major events such as the first look, vows, and speeches. Create separate pages to emphasize these milestones, allowing for detailed reflections or quotes.
    3. Thematic Sections: Group related memories together, like decorations, flowers, and candid moments. This creates a seamless flow and makes it easier for you to revisit specific aspects of your day.
    1. Quality Over Quantity: Select high-quality photos that capture emotions and important details. Focus on images that convey the spirit of the day, rather than trying to include every single shot.
    2. Diverse Shots: Include a mix of wide-angle shots and close-ups. Group family portraits, couples’ moments, and candid shots together to showcase different perspectives.
    3. Memento Integration: Incorporate tangible items such as invitations, programs, and dried flowers. These elements add texture and help create a multi-dimensional scrapbook.
    4. Use Labels and Captions: Label your photos with dates, locations, and short anecdotes. This context enriches the viewing experience and brings your memories to life.

    Inspiration from Real Weddings

    For couples seeking ideas, real weddings provide endless inspiration for creating stunning scrapbooks. Observing how others captured their special day can spark your creativity and help you tailor your scrapbook to reflect your unique style.

    • Rustic Charm: Use natural elements like twine, burlap, and wood textures. Couples often incorporate these items, creating a cozy, down-to-earth feel.
    • Elegant Lace: Incorporate lace details for a timeless look. Many couples opt for a vintage aesthetic by layering lace over patterned paper or using lace-themed embellishments.
    • Beach Vibes: Gather seashells or sand to create a beach-themed scrapbook. You might see couples incorporating navy and white colors, coupled with beach-themed stickers and photos of beach moments.
    • Bold Colors: Choose a vibrant color palette that represents your style. Real weddings often highlight bold colors through vivid scrapbook papers, which complement photos beautifully.
    • Photo Booth Fun: Include candid shots from your wedding’s photo booth. These spontaneous moments lend a playful touch and capture the joy of your celebration.
    • Cultural Inspirations: Reflect your heritage by incorporating traditional items or symbols. Couples regularly showcase cultural elements through colors, motifs, or ceremonies, enhancing the storytelling aspect.
    • Interactive Elements: Add flip pages or pockets. Couples who incorporate these components make their scrapbooks engaging and keep the viewers curious.
    • Personalized Covers: Design a unique cover using elements from your wedding invitation or a monogram. Couples often find this a perfect way to set the tone for the scrapbook.
